KLOW peptides are a proprietary multi-component research blend. The name refers to the first letters of the principal components in the most common industry formulation: Kisspeptin, LL-37, Oxytocin, and the Wolverine Blend (BPC-157 plus TB-500). Velora supplies KLOW as an 80mg lyophilized research compound for in vitro and preclinical investigation only. Verify exact component ratios against the active Certificate of Analysis.
In published preclinical literature, the individual KLOW components have been characterized across h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al-axis research (Kisspeptin-10), antimicrobial peptide and tissue-remodeling research (LL-37), neuropeptide-signaling research (Oxytocin), and tissue-remodeling and angiogenesis research (Wolverine Blend). Store the lyophilized vial sealed at -20°C in a dry, dark environment. Once reconstituted with bacteriostatic water, refrigerate at 2 to 8°C and use within the stability window established by the research protocol. Avoid repeat freeze-thaw cycles, which can degrade peptide integrity, especially for the smaller components in a multi-peptide blend.
